Transaction 16ef34aa71c70f0c406b99f9f351d438578d50ae62ddeaa443d1a4d386543718
1 Input
2 Outputs
- 16ef34aa71c70f0c406b99f9f351d438578d50ae62ddeaa443d1a4d386543718:0
- 16ef34aa71c70f0c406b99f9f351d438578d50ae62ddeaa443d1a4d386543718:1
value 20000000
address 1FtZW7QxxCvwWv2MZKZzpWb5cXJxJkCE5F
value 29973964
address 1MP28hQmUJCVKeG2ypdofFG7yQVATJ81S3